Location and Contact Information

Bull Run Regional Park is located in Centreville, Virginia, which is part of the Northern Virginia region. This park is managed by the Northern Virginia Regional Park Authority (NOVA Parks).

Campground Amenities

Bull Run Regional Park offers a variety of amenities to make your camping experience enjoyable:

  • Campsites for tents and RVs, with electric and water hookups available
  • Dump station for RVs
  • Bathhouses with showers and restrooms
  • Picnic areas and shelters
  • A camp store (with limited supplies and hours)
  • Playgrounds for children
  • Hiking trails
  • Disc golf course

Activities and Events

The park offers a range of activities and seasonal events:

  • Access to hiking and nature trails
  • Occasional special events like festivals and holiday-themed festivities
  • Atlantis Waterpark (seasonal) is also located within the park
  • The Annual Bull Run Festival of Lights, which typically runs from November to January, is a popular attraction

Park Rules and Regulations

To ensure the safety and enjoyment of all visitors, Bull Run Regional Park has several rules in place:

  • Observe quiet hours typically from 10 PM to 6 AM
  • Pets are allowed but must be kept on a leash
  • Alcohol is prohibited unless consumed at a reserved picnic shelter and with an alcohol permit from NOVA Parks
  • Fires are allowed in designated areas and must be extinguished before leaving the site
  • Check-in and check-out times must be adhered to
  • Maximum stay limitations may apply

It is important to check for specific rules and regulations when making your reservation or upon arrival.

Directions and Transportation

Bull Run Regional Park is accessible by car:

  • Easily reached via I-66; take Exit 52 for Centreville, and follow signs to Bull Run Drive
  • Public transportation to the park is limited, and the use of a personal vehicle or taxi/rideshare is recommended

Always consult a map or GPS for the most accurate and current directions.
